Fresno County Suing California Over Yokuts Valley Name Change, Asking Public Input

Fresno County Suing California Over Yokuts Valley Name Change, Asking Public Input

FRESNO, CA (KMJ) – Fresno County is suing the state of California over the Yokuts Valley name change and asking for the public’s input. In February, the California Board on Geographic Names changed Squaw Valley, considered a derogatory term for Native American women, to “Yokuts” which translates to “people.” Governor Gavin Newsom signed AB22 requiring…MORE

Bitwise Officially Fires All Employees

Bitwise Officially Fires All Employees

Two weeks after news broke of possible financial wrongdoing and hundreds of furloughs, local tech incubator Bitwise officially terminated all 900 employees on Wednesday via email.
